Output ec731d14960365b0d23a7ee2a74c7e00f75a4c15071e374024e6abf990a0b576:24

value
9359561
script pubkey
OP_0 OP_PUSHBYTES_20 18ff37fa5d8ba17747e03b896d2f49ca2d28b763
address
bc1qrrln07ja3wshw3lq8wyk6t6fegkj3dmrk2pwhm
transaction
ec731d14960365b0d23a7ee2a74c7e00f75a4c15071e374024e6abf990a0b576
spent
true